If you want to keep the changer stick with another sony headunit, as a sony changer wouldnt be compatible with different brand aftermarket H/U, however with MP3 CD function, it is making CD changers old hat. if you do want a sony then the Sony CDX-DAB6650 would be a good bet, as its got a hidden CD slot, Face off, and boasts DAB, only costs about 150quid if your not bothered about DAB check out the sony Sony MEX-1GP similar spec, only without the DAB and the radio face is a 1gigabite storage device so you can listen to the music on that,

Post by: Rhyso on 04 July 2006, 11:03
have you tried saving the station after pressing the AF button?

AF button means it will scan for alternate frequencies instead of you having to faf around with it.  but unless you save the station after pressing the button it doesn't remember what to do.

at least that was the case for mini disc player I had  :undecided:
